This document outlines 7 synchronization (sync) parameters for connecting a generator to a bus bar including: the maximum and minimum allowable frequency difference between the generator and bus bar (0.3 Hz and 0 Hz), the maximum allowable voltage difference of 5%, timers of 50 ms for switching on the generator and main breakers, and a closing window of 10 degrees for the phase difference in voltage.
